Coast Brewing Blackbeerd, the Imperial Stout
As dark as the legend of Blackbeerd himself, behold the Imperial Stout. Sweet malts battle roasted grain on the decks of yer tongue. Like a blast from a cannon, hop are followed by smoked malt. Hold on to yer booty, a dark stouts a brewin’. (9.3% abv) Seasonal-winter. Ingredients: Two-row barley*, Black, Caraffa*, Roasted barley*, Smoked, Oats*, Black Prinze andExtra Special* malts, Magnum and Palisades hops. Barrel Aged Blackbeerd is designated by black waxing: Jack Daniels Barrel Aged (’09), Buffalo Trace Aged (’10), JD and Buffalo Trace (’11).

Coast Brewing 32/50 Kolsch
Our take on a kolsch style ale that is soft on the palate with a delicate malt flavor. Balanced with a touch of wheat and honey notes .Dry and wine like with a flowery hop finish. (4.8% abv) Brewed Year Round. Ingredients: Pilsner*, Vienna*, Wheat*, Carahelle* and Carapils malts, Tradition and Halletaur hops. *Certified Organic Malt

Coast Brewing HopArt IPA
Walking a fine line of sweet malt and assertive hop character. A hop presence so enticing it truly is a work of art. (7.7% abv). Brewed year-round. Ingredients: Two-barley*, Munich* and Caramel 20* malts, Nugget, Millennium and Cascade hops. *Certified Organic Malt

Coast Brewing Company
COAST Brewing Co. is a small, family owned craft brewery – Located across from Noisette Creek on the Old Navy Base. We believe in utilizing alternative means to brew unique beer. We also believe in choice organic and local ingredients. From our biodiesel fired kettle to our energy efficient process, we forge hand crafted batches on our 7 bbl brewhouse.

Thornbridge Saint Petersburg
Dark brown with a creamy tan head, almost latte like in appearance. Lemony, minty hop nose with underlying chocolate-caramel. Big, sweet roasted malt in the mouth with hints of chicory and bitter coffee. Some dark chocolate and wisps of peaty smoke. Boozy, bitter finish with some roasted hazelnut and maple syrup characters. Nice, slightly dry, bitter ending.
